DisDisDis posted:

the real strong thing about short blades (strength is an infinite dump stat and you get tons of dv) is still strong it's just less accessible to new/less tryhard players because you need to know how to handle yourself til you get a vibroblade (and i guess this playstyle is really more about being a defensive stance longblade user who picks up the vibrokhopesh than about shortblades now)

e: and by 'still really strong' i mean as of a year + ago when i still played this game a lot and tried to make strong characters. now im a wisened sage who will make a 27 starting willpower greybeard once every 6 months

what was busted about short blades is there used to be a skill that let you substitute agility for strength in penetration rolls. it wasn't necessarily the single most broken thing in the game, but it was the easiest and most passive. you just went all-in on agility and spent the rest of the game with max penetration and only getting hit on a natural 20

vibroblades are great and all but they're a "when you've already mostly won the game you can sub these in for slightly better results against hard targets"

e: a good way to put it is that an agility-focused build still works, more or less, it's just that now you actually have to pay your dues for it :v:

victrix posted:

Can anyone point me to the true power of the arcologies that I'm missing?

You're not missing anything. Mutants are just stronger.

(As long as you're making at least a modestly informed attempt to optimize and not picking mutations at random or something).

victrix posted:

Can anyone point me to the true power of the arcologies that I'm missing?

True Kin really just trades the absolutely busted potential of a Mutant in favor of a much easier early game (in the sense that you can play sloppy and come out alive, obviously Freezing Hands+Teleport trivializes everything if you have the patience). Also you can put skillpoints in QOL stuff earlier because of the extra attributes and skill points, and personally getting lost over and over and over again drives me completely loving insane, so being able to afford Mind's Compass without feeling like I'm missing out on something important is a big deal. I like TK but they're basically on par with medium-effort Mutant builds.
